Purchased a certified pre-owned Mazda product from a different Mazda dealership. The car has a little over 50,000 miles on it. The powertrain warranty is 100,000 miles. The vehicle developed a powertrain issue. Duncan Mazda claimed the issue was not covered under my powertrain warranty and would cost between $5,000 and $6,000 to fix. They wouldn't contact Mazda directly to explain the situation. I spoke with the owner of Duncan Mazda. Here was his main point to me: "Your problem is, you didn't buy the car from me." It gets better. I decided to take the car to Modern Automotive in Christiansburg, VA. If I'm going to pay someone to do the work, it will be someone I trust. They inspected the vehicle, purchased the parts needed from the Mazda dealer in Roanoke, and fixed the car for $3500. As it turns out my front CV Joints that Duncan claimed were leaking and needing replacement, were actually in near perfect condition! Someone at Duncan was trying to rip me off. I will never take a vehicle to Duncan Mazda again. Be careful with these folks!

Dealer response

My apologies for the Negative sentiment that you have towards your Mazda CPO CX-9. To reiterate, the reason that your repair was not covered by Mazda North American Operations was due to the fact that the Selling Mazda Dealer that you purchased it from in Atlanta, GA Certified your Mazda CX-9 with the incorrect size tires. The Vehicle should have never been Mazda Certified in the first place. These incorrect size tires were also at different tread depths. This ultimately caused your issue in the rear differential of your Mazda CX-9. Our recommendations to you were to contact the selling dealer to discuss and ask for assistance. Furthermore, you declined any and all assistance from Duncan Mazda. Looking back at the original quote for repair our Rear Differential Repair proposal was approx. $700 cheaper than the Independent garage that you chose to work with.
